1

Ultimate Guide for Hiring a roof replacement contractor atlanta

News Discuss 
Your Overview to Reliable Roof Covering Services: From Installments to Substitutes Reputable roofing services are vital for home owners seeking to secure their investments. Understanding the different roofing materials and the value of specialist examinations can considerably affect the durability of a roof covering. When to replace or repair is https://perthroofingcompany86395.izrablog.com/36731129/why-quality-matters-in-siding-installation-services

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story